- Anti-GPR68 (OGR1) (extracellular) Antibody (ABIN7043170, ABIN7044425 and ABIN7044426) is a highly specific antibody directed against an epitope of the mouse ovarian cancer G-protein coupled receptor 1. The antibody can be used in western blot and live cell flow cytometry applications. It has been designed to recognize GPR68 from rat, mouse, and human samples.

Synonyms: Acid-sensing G-protein coupled receptor 68, Ovarian cancer G-protein coupled receptor 1, Sphingosylphosphorylcholine receptor
Description: All GPCRs, including GPR68, are single peptides possessing seven transmembrane domains with an extracellular N-terminus and an intracellular C-terminus1. GPR68 is expressed in several tissues including the spleen, testis, small bowel, brain, heart, lung and kidneys. It shares strong homology (49-54 % ) with the human receptor GPR42.GPR68 is proton sensitive in the pH range of 6.8-7.8 and acts as a proton activated receptor. GPR68 stimulates inositol triphosphate (IP3) formation thereby releasing intracellular calcium and activating the mitogen activated protein kinase/extracellular signal-regulated (ERK) kinase cascade. In addition, GPR68 receptor regulates NHE3 and H+-ATPase, in response to extracellular pH changes in cultured HEK 293 renal cells. This activation requires a cluster of histidine residues in the extracellular domains of the receptor and protein-kinase C (PKC) activation4.
